Meme Coins: Temporary Hype or Real Opportunity?

In recent years, meme coins have gone from being a joke to becoming a real craze in the crypto world. Projects like Dogecoin (DOGE) and Shiba Inu (SHIB) have shown that a simple meme can generate billions of dollars in market value. But are meme coins a solid investment or just a passing hype?

What Are Meme Coins? Meme coins are cryptocurrencies inspired by memes, pop culture, and internet trends. Unlike traditional projects that offer clear utility, many meme coins start as jokes or community-driven initiatives but gain traction through massive social media support.

Why Are They Worth So Much? FOMO and Community: The Fear of Missing Out (FOMO) drives massive buying. Celebrity Influence: Elon Musk has moved Dogecoin’s price with a single tweet. Low Entry Cost: Many meme coins are cheap, attracting small investors. Viral Narratives: Organic marketing and memes help spread the coin rapidly. The Downside of Meme Coins Not everything is sunshine and rainbows. Many meme coins are highly volatile and can lose value quickly. Additionally, some projects lack solid fundamentals and may be rug pulls—scams where creators disappear with investors' money.

So, Is It Worth Investing? If you're looking for quick profits and are willing to take risks, meme coins can be a fun option. However, it's crucial to Do Your Own Research (DYOR) and understand that these assets are highly speculative.

The future of meme coins remains uncertain, but one thing is clear: as long as the internet loves memes, they will continue to exist! 🚀
